- Director: Thomas Arslan
- Country: Germany
- Year: 2007
- Principal cast: Angela Winkler, Karoline Eichhorn, Uwe Bohm, Gudrun Ritter, Anja Schneider
- Producer: Thomas Arslan
- Screenplay: Thomas Arslan
- Print source: Pickpocket Film Produktion
Rohmer meets Bergman in this sophisticated
and supremely intelligent drama about three
generations of a family coming together –
and coming apart – at their vacation home
in the lovely Uckermark region of Germany.
When Anna, Robert and their teenage son Max
plan out their summer vacation at their idyllic
summer home, they didn’t expect a lengthy
visitation from their entire extended family.
But that’s exactly what happens as more
and more relatives show up and make
themselves at home. At first everything
goes swimmingly, people are on their best
behaviour, but before long fissures begin
to appear. Put enough family members in
one place at one time, and you have a recipe
for combustion, and as secrets are revealed
and feelings escalate the fate of one family
hangs in the balance.
Thomas Arslan’s film, with its close attention
to family dynamics inside an enclosed space
examines the tenuous surfaces that hide
a world of complexity. Within the seeming
quiet of the forest. “It’s a testament to writerdirector
Thomas Arslan that Vacation… feels
so fresh and absorbing.”
